As discussed during the dispatch call, emergency medical services transported an elderly woman experiencing possible stroke symptoms, including unequal grip and disorientation. The patient had been unwell for several days and previously visited the emergency room. Paramedics reported stable vital signs and an estimated arrival of 12 to 15 minutes to Rice Memorial Hospital in Willmar, Minnesota.
